National Bank releases a monthly house price index … WebFeb 7, 2006 · Landlord and tenant law, governed by provincial statutes and judge-made law, varies considerably from province to province. Essentially, a landlord and tenant relationship is contractual ( see CONTRACT LAW ). WebTenant owes 3 duties to landlord. Duty to fulfill the express obligations in the lease (pay rent). Implied duties not to commit waste or maintain a nuisance. Duty to vacate at the end of the lease term. Remedies for tenant's breach and for holding over. Landlord's primary goal is to evict the tenant. WebLandlord-tenant law governs the rental of commercial and residential property. It is composed primarily of state statutes and common law. A number of states have based their statutory law on either the Uniform Residential Landlord And Tenant Act (URLTA) or the Model Residential Landlord-Tenant Code.
